/* RTL Support */
.topbar-inner {
    display: flex;
    justify-content: space-between;
}

.topbar-inner #langchange {
    margin-right: 15px;
}

.info-bar-inner {
    display: flex;
    justify-content: space-between;
}

.info-bar-inner .right-content .request-quote {
    margin-left: 0px;
    margin-right: 40px;
}

.info-items li .single-info-item .icon {
    margin-right: 0px;
    margin-left: 20px;
}

.info-items li {
    margin: 0;
}

.info-items li + li {
    margin-right: 30px !important;
}

.navbar-area.nav-style-01 .nav-container .navbar-collapse .navbar-nav,
.navbar-area .nav-container .navbar-collapse .navbar-nav li.menu-item-has-children .sub-menu {
    text-align: right;
}

.navbar-area .nav-container .navbar-collapse .navbar-nav li:first-child {
    margin-left: 20px;
}

.header-area {
    text-align: right;
}

.desktop-left {
    text-align: right;
}

.icon-box-one {
    text-align: right;
}

.icon-box-one .icon {
    margin-right: 0px;
    margin-left: 20px;
}

.header-bottom-area .right-content-area {
    background-position: top left;
}

.icon-box-two {
    text-align: right;
}

.icon-box-two .icon {
    margin-right: 0px;
    margin-left: 20px;
}

.cta-area-one .left-content-area {
    text-align: right;
}

.single-work-item .content {
    text-align: right;
}

.singler-counterup-item-01 .icon {
    margin-right: 0px;
    margin-left: 20px;
}

.singler-counterup-item-01 {
    text-align: right;
}

.singler-counterup-item-01.white .content .count-wrap {
    display: flex;
}

.single-blog-grid-01 {
    text-align: right;
}

.newsletter-area .right-side-content form .submit-btn {
    right: auto;
    left: 0;
    text-align: center;
    border-top-right-radius: 0;
    border-bottom-right-radius: 0;
    border-top-left-radius: 5px;
    border-bottom-left-radius: 5px;
}

.newsletter-area .right-side-content form input {
    padding-right: 20px;
    padding-left: 70px;
}

.widget.footer-widget {
    text-align: right;
}

.widget .recent_post_item li.single-recent-post-item .thumb {
    margin-right: 0;
    margin-left: 20px;
}

.newsletter-area {
    text-align: right;
}

.header-bottom-area .right-content-area {
    text-align: right;
    padding-right: 60px;
    padding-left: 150px;
}

.info-bar-inner #langchange {
    margin-left: 0;
    margin-right: 15px;
}

.info-items-two li .single-info-item {
    flex-direction: row;
    text-align: right;
}

.info-items-two li .single-info-item .content .title {
    display: flex;
}

.info-items-two li .single-info-item .content .title span {
    margin-left: 0;
    margin-right: 10px;
}

.info-items-two li .single-info-item .icon {
    margin-right: 0;
    margin-left: 15px;
}

.header-top-style-03 .navbar-area .nav-container {
    padding-left: 0;
    padding-right: 30px;
}

.header-top-style-03 .navbar-area .nav-container .navbar-brand {
    margin-right: 0;
    margin-left: 15px;
}

.header-top-style-03 .navbar-area .nav-container .nav-right-content {
    margin-left: 0px;
    margin-right: 40px;
}

.header-top-style-03 .navbar-area .nav-container .nav-right-content .get-quote:before {
    left: auto;
    right: -15px;
}

.header-top-style-03 .navbar-area .nav-container .nav-right-content .get-quote:after {
    right: -5px;
    left: auto;
    content: "\f104";
}

.header-top-style-03 .navbar-area .nav-container .nav-right-content .get-quote {
    padding: 0 40px 0 30px;
}

.info-items-two li {
    margin: 0px;
}

.info-items-two li + li {
    margin-right: 30px !important;
}

.breadcrumb-area .page-list li {
    padding-left: 0;
    padding-right: 30px;
}

.breadcrumb-area .page-list li:after {
    left: auto;
    right: 10px;
}

.breadcrumb-inner {
    text-align: right;
}

.who-we-area .left-content-area .aboutus-content-block {
    text-align: right;
    padding-right: 0;
    padding-left: 80px;
}

.icon-box-three {
    text-align: right;
}

.icon-box-three .icon {
    margin-right: 0;
    margin-left: 20px;
}

.single-work-item-02 {
    text-align: right;
}

.footer-widget.widget_nav_menu ul li a:after {
    left: auto;
    right: 0;
    content: "\f104";
}

.footer-widget.widget_nav_menu ul li a {
    padding-left: 0;
    padding-right: 15px;
}

.breadcrumb-area .page-list li:first-child {
    padding-right: 0px;
}

.single-team-member-one:hover .thumb .hover .social-icon li:nth-child(1) {
    -ms-transform: translateX(-20px);
    -webkit-transform: translateX(-20px);
    transform: translateX(-20px);
}

.single-team-member-one:hover .thumb .hover .social-icon li:nth-child(2) {
    -ms-transform: translateX(-20px);
    -webkit-transform: translateX(-20px);
    transform: translateX(-20px);
}

.single-team-member-one:hover .thumb .hover .social-icon li:nth-child(3) {
    -ms-transform: translateX(-20px);
    -webkit-transform: translateX(-20px);
    transform: translateX(-20px);
}

.accordion-wrapper .card {
    text-align: right;
}

.accordion-wrapper .card .card-header a:after {
    right: auto;
    left: 30px;
}

.accordion-wrapper .card .card-header a {
    padding-left: 60px;
}

.dynamic-page-content-area {
    text-align: right;
}

.widget_search .search-form .submit-btn {
    left: 0;
    right: auto;
    border-radius: 0;
    border-top-left-radius: 5px;
    border-bottom-left-radius: 5px;
}


.widget_search .search-form .form-group .form-control {
    padding-right: 20px;
    padding-left: 70px;
}

.widget {
    text-align: right;
}

.contact-page .submit-btn {
    float: right;
}

.contact-info-list .single-contact-info {
    text-align: right;
}

.contact-info-list .single-contact-info .icon {
    margin-right: 0;
    margin-left: 20px;
}

.alert {
    text-align: right;
}

.navbar-area .nav-container .navbar-collapse .navbar-nav li.menu-item-has-children:before {
    right: auto;
    left: 0;
}
@media only screen and (max-width: 991px) {
 .navbar-area .nav-container .navbar-brand .navbar-toggler {
        position: absolute;
        right: 285px;
        border: 1px solid #e2e2e2;
    }
 }
.navbar-area .nav-container .navbar-collapse .navbar-nav li.menu-item-has-children {
    padding-right: 0;
    padding-left: 15px;
}

.blog-details-item {
    text-align: right;
}

.portfolio-details-item {
    text-align: right;
}

.project-info-item {
    text-align: right;
}

.project-info-item ul li {
    display: flex;
}

.project-info-item ul li .right {
    margin-right: 20px;
}

.service-details-item {
    text-align: right;
}

.order-content-area {
    text-align: right;
}

.portfolio-menu li + li {
    margin-left: 0px;
    margin-right: 20px;
}

.aboutus-content-block.style-02 {
    text-align: right;
}

.header-bottom-list li:after {
    left: 0;
    right: -15px;
}

.aboutus-content-block {
    text-align: right;
}

.single-header-bottom-list-item {
    text-align: right;
}

.single-header-bottom-list-item .icon {
    margin-right: 0;
    margin-left: 20px;
}

.single-header-bottom-list-item .bg-icon {
    right: auto;
    left: 0;
}

.header-bottom-list li + li {
    margin-left: 0;
    margin-right: 20px;
}

.single-experience-item {
    text-align: right;
}

.single-testimonial-item-02 .description .icon {
    margin-right: 0;
    margin-left: 20px;
}

.request-call {
    text-align: right;
}

.form-group.file {
    text-align: right;
}

.form-group.checkbox {
    text-align: right;
}

div#gdpr-cookie-message {
    text-align: right;
}

div#gdpr-cookie-message #gdpr-cookie-close {
    right: auto;
    left: 10px;
}

.single-job-list-item {
    text-align: right;
}

.single-job-list-item .jobs-meta li + li {
    margin-left: 0px;
    margin-right: 20px;
}

.single-job-details {
    text-align: right;
}

.job-information-list li .single-job-info .icon {
    margin-right: 0px;
    margin-left: 20px;
}

.job-meta-list li .single-job-meta-block ul li:before {
    content: "\f100";
    margin-right: 0px;
    margin-left: 5px;
}

.payment-gateway-wrapper ul li + li {
    margin-left: 0px;
    margin-right: 15px;
}

.order-confirm-area {
    text-align: right;
}

.single-events-list-item .content-area .top-part .title-wrap {
    text-align: right;
}

.single-events-list-item .thumb {
    margin-right: 0px;
    margin-left: 30px;
}

.single-events-list-item .content-area .top-part .time-wrap {
    margin-right: 0px;
    margin-left: 20px;
}

.single-event-details .content .top-part {
    text-align: right;
}

.single-event-details .content .top-part .time-wrap {
    margin-right: 0px;
    margin-left: 20px;
}

.single-knowledgebase-list-item .title,
.article-with-topic-title-style-01 .topic-title,
.article-with-topic-title-style-01 ul.know-articles-list {
    text-align: right;
}

.related-work-area .section-title {
    text-align: right;
}

.mlotfi_admin_bar .left-content-part ul li + li {
    margin-left: 0;
    margin-right: 20px;
}

.mlotfi_admin_bar .right-content-part .author-details-wrap .author-link {
    left: 0;
    right: auto;
}

.header-jobs-area .header-area .right-image-wrapper {
    right: auto;
    left: 12%;
}

.search-wrapper .search-btn {
    right: auto;
    left: 5px;
}

.millions-job-area .right-content-image-wrapper {
    right: auto;
    left: 5%;
}

.single-blog-grid-10 .content .post-meta li + li {
    margin-left: 0;
    margin-right: 20px;
}


.single-testimonial-item-10 .top-part .author {
    margin-left: 0;
    margin-right: 20px;
    text-align: right;
}

.newsletter-form-wrap .submit-btn {
    right: auto;
    left: 0;
}

.gallery-masonry-nav li + li {
    margin-left: 0;
    margin-right: 20px;
}

.product-archive-top-content-area .search-form .form-control {
    padding-right: 20px;
    padding-left: 60px;
}

.product-archive-top-content-area .search-form button {
    right: auto;
    left: 0;
}

.single-gig-item .thumb .order-btn {
    right: auto;
    left: 20px;
}

.single-gig-item .thumb .price-wrap {
    left: auto;
    right: 20px;
}


.gig-price-plan,
.get-quote-wrapper,
.single-gig-details .content-area,
.single-gig-item .content,
.single-testimonial-item-10 .bottom-part,
.single-blog-grid-10,
.testimonial-area .section-title ,
.single-latest-job-post .top-part-wrap .left-top-part,
.single-latest-job-post .bottom-part-warp ul,
.single-product-item-3 .content,
.single-product-details .top-content .product-summery,
.single-product-details .extra-content-wrap .nav-tabs{
    text-align: right;
}
.gig-price-plan .feature-list li:before {
    padding-right: 0;
    padding-left: 20px;
}


.single-product-details .top-content > div:first-child {
    margin-right: 0;
    margin-left: 30px;
}
.single-product-details .extra-content-wrap .nav-tabs .nav-item:first-child {
    border-top-left-radius: 0;
    border-top-right-radius: 5px;
}
.single-product-details .extra-content-wrap .nav-tabs .nav-item:last-child {
    border-top-right-radius: 0px;
    border-top-left-radius: 5px;
}
.single-product-details .extra-content-wrap .nav-tabs .nav-item + .nav-item {
    border-left: none;
    border-right: 1px solid #e2e2e2;
}
.single-product-details .extra-content-wrap .tab-content,
.contribute-single-item .content{
    text-align: right;
}
.contribute-single-item.grid-item .boxed-btn {
    width: auto;
    min-width: auto;
}
.contribute-single-item .goal {
    flex-direction: row-reverse;
}
.percentCount{
    right: 0;
}
.donation_wrapper {
    text-align: right;
}
.form-check-label {
    padding-right: 30px;
}

.single-blog-grid-01 .content .post-meta li + li {
    margin-left: 0;
    margin-right: 10px;
}

.user-dashboard-wrapper > ul {
    padding: 0;
}
.user-dashboard-card .icon {
    margin-right: 0;
    margin-left: 20px;
}

.user-dashboard-card,
.cart-total-wrap,
.dashboard-form-wrapper,
.order-service-page-content-area .nav-tabs,
.billing-details-fields-wrapper,
.shipping-details-wrapper,
.checkout-wrapper,
.product-orders-summery-warp .extra-data,
.billing-wrap,
.product-orders-summery-warp .title,
.single-event-details,
.info-bar-area.style-three .info-bar-inner .right-content ul,
.header-charity-area .navbar-area.nav-style-02 .nav-container .navbar-collapse .navbar-nav,
.about-us-area .right-content-wrap,
.single-service-item-09 .content,
.single-event-item .content .top-part,
.single-new-item-09 .content{
    text-align: right;
}
.billing-and-shipping-details ul li strong{
    margin-left: 30px;
    margin-right: 0;
}
.cart-total-table {
    text-align: right !important;
}
.event-info .icon-with-title-description li .icon {
    margin-right: 0;
    margin-left: 15px;
}
.info-bar-inner .language_dropdown {
    margin-left: 0;
    margin-right: 20px;
}
.header-top-style-03 .navbar-area.home-variant-09 .nav-container .nav-right-content {
    margin-left: -30px;
}
.single-service-item-09 .icon {
    margin-right: 0;
    margin-left: 30px;
}
.single-event-item .content .top-part .time-wrap {
    margin-right: 0;
    margin-left: 20px;
}
.section-title{
    text-align: center;
}
.single-testimonial-item-09 .author-meta .content {
    margin-left: 0;
    margin-right: 20px;
    text-align: right;
}
.single-new-item-09 .content .post-meta li + li {
    margin-left: 0;
    margin-right: 20px;
}
.product-home-header-area.style-03,
.decorate-area .left-content-wrapper,
.testimonial-area .left-content-wrapper,
.single-carousel-item-08 .top-part .content,
.single-carousel-item-08 .bottom-part,
.single-event-item-style-07 .content,
.news-item-style-06 .content,
.single-highlight-item,
.single-popular-article-wrap .article-list,
.single-testimonial-item-05 .author-details .author,
.cta-inner-wrapper .left-content-wrap,
.user-dashboard-wrapper
{
    text-align: right;
}
.product-home-header-area .right-image-wrap,
.decorate-area .right-image-wrap{
    right: auto;
    left: 50px;
}
.decorate-area .right-image-wrap:after{
    right: auto;
    left: -200px;
}
.decorate-area .left-content-wrapper .title:after {
    right: -80px;
    left: auto;
}
.latest-product-filter-nav ul li+li {
    margin-left: 0;
    margin-right: 20px;
}
.product-section-title:after {
    right: -80px;
    left: auto;
}
.single-carousel-item-08 .top-part .thumb {
    margin-right: 0;
    margin-left: 20px;
}
.single-carousel-item-08 .bottom-part i {
    margin-right: 0;
    margin-left: 20px;
}
.cta-inner-area .left-content {
    text-align: right;
    margin-right: 0;
}
.cta-inner-area .right-content .newsletter-form-wrap .submit-btn {
    right: auto;
    left: 5px;
}
.newsletter-form-wrap .form-group .form-control {
    padding-left: 70px;
    padding-right: 20px;
}
.nx-singular-countdown-item + .nx-singular-countdown-item {
    margin-left: 0;
    margin-right: 40px;
}
.featured-event-area-wrapper .left-content-wrap {
     width: auto;
     padding-right: 0px;
}
.single-event-item-style-07 .content .time-warp {
    margin-right: 0;
    margin-left: 20px;
}
.header-area-wrapper .right-image-wrap {
    right: auto;
    left: 5%;
}
.news-item-style-06 .content .post-meta li+li {
    margin-left: 0;
    margin-right: 20px;
}
.testimonial-area .section-title {
    padding-right: 0;
}
.about_us_widget .social-icons li + li {
    margin-left: 0;
    margin-right: 10px;
}
.single-highlight-item .content {
    margin-left: 0;
    margin-right: 20px;
}
.single-popular-article-wrap .title {
    text-align: right;
    padding-left: 0;
    padding-right: 20px;
}

.single-popular-article-wrap .title:after {
    left: auto;
    right: 0;
}
.single-testimonial-item-05 .author-details .thumb {
    margin-right: 0;
    margin-left: 20px;
}

.millions-job-area {
    text-align: right;
}


/* Create three columns of equal width */
.columns {
  float: right;
  width: 33.3%;
  padding: 8px;
}

/* Style the list */
.price {
  list-style-type: none;
  border: 1px solid #eee;
  margin: 0;
  padding: 0;
  -webkit-transition: 0.3s;
  transition: 0.3s;
}

/* Add shadows on hover */
.price:hover {
  box-shadow: 0 8px 12px 0 rgba(0,0,0,0.2)
}

/* Pricing header */
.price .header {
  background-color: #111;
  color: white;
  font-size: 25px;
}

/* List items */
.price li {
  border-bottom: 1px solid #eee;
  padding: 20px;
  text-align: right;
}

/* Grey list item */
.price .grey {
  background-color: #eee;
  font-size: 20px;
}

/* The "Sign Up" button */
.button {
  background-color: #04AA6D;
  border: none;
  color: white;
  padding: 10px 25px;
  text-align: center;
  text-decoration: none;
  font-size: 18px;
}

/* Change the width of the three columns to 100%
(to stack horizontally on small screens) */
@media only screen and (max-width: 600px) {
  .columns {
    width: 100%;
  }
}